In a RGB color space, hex #cbb8c0 is made of 35% red, 32% green and 33% blue. In a HSL mode Mauve Finery has a hue angle of 334.74°, a saturation of 15.45% and a lightness of 75.88%. In a CMYK space (used in printing only), hex #cbb8c0 is made of 0% cyan, 7.45% magenta, 4.32% yellow and 20.39% black ink.
